VPS参考测评推荐
专注分享VPS主机优惠信息
衡天云优惠活动
华纳云优惠活动
荫云优惠活动

SSL证书的加密算法有哪些?主要有五种(ssl加密技术的基本原理)

主机参考:VPS测评参考推荐/专注分享VPS服务器优惠信息!若您是商家可以在本站进行投稿,查看详情!此外我们还提供软文收录、PayPal代付、广告赞助等服务,查看详情!
我们发布的部分优惠活动文章可能存在时效性,购买时建议在本站搜索商家名称可查看相关文章充分了解该商家!若非中文页面可使用Edge浏览器同步翻译!PayPal代付/收录合作

SSL证书主要使用https加密算法来保证网站的安全性,那么SSL证书有多少种加密算法呢?以下是一些主要的加密算法。

1.DES对称加密算法

DES加密算法是最早的加密算法之一。其原理是将64位纯文本数据块分成两个独立的32位块并对每个块进行加密,从而将64位纯文本数据块转换为密文。

DES最大的缺点是加密密钥短,容易被暴力破解。因此,目前已不再使用,并于2005年正式废弃。

2.3DES加密算法

3DES是DES算法的升级版本,于20世纪90年代末投入使用。3DSE算法对每个数据块应用三次,这使得它比DES更难破解。但与DES一样,研究人员也在3DES算法中发现了严重的安全漏洞,这导致美国标准与技术研究所宣布将在2023年后放弃使用3DES算法。

3.AES对称加密算法

AES是DES算法的替代方案,也是最常用的加密算法之一。与DES不同,AES是一组分组密码,由不同密钥长度和分组大小的密码组成。AES算法首先将明文数据转换为块,然后使用密钥对其进行加密。AES密钥的长度为128、192或256位,数据用128位的块加密和解密,安全性要高得多。目前,它被广泛应用于金融事务、在线交易、无线通信、数字存储等领域。

4.RSA非对称算法

RSA是目前应用最广泛的非对称算法,其安全性基于其所依赖的素数分解。根据数论,找到两个大素数相对简单,但分解它们的乘积却极其困难,因此乘积可以作为加密密钥公开。事实证明,如今的超级计算机很难破解RSA算法。2010年,一组研究人员模拟了768位RSA算法,发现用超级计算机破解该算法至少需要1500年。目前RSA普遍使用2048位密钥,破解难度可想而知。因此,RSA算法提出至今已近30年,并经过各种攻击的考验,逐渐被人们所接受。它被普遍认为是目前最好的公钥方案之一。

5.ECC非对称加密算法

ECC又称椭圆曲线加密算法,是一种基于椭圆曲线数学理论的非对称加密算法。与RSA相比,ECC可以使用更短的密钥来实现与RSA相同甚至更高的安全性。根据目前的研究,160位ECC加密安全性相当于1024位RSA加密,210位ECC加密安全性相当于2048位RSA加密。较短的密钥只需要较少的网络负载和计算能力,因此在SSL证书中使用ECC算法可以大大减少SSL握手时间并缩短网站响应时间。

以上是SSL证书的主要加密算法。此外,还有SM2等加密算法。不同的算法水平也会影响SSL证书的价格。大家可以根据自己的需求选择合适的证书。

这几篇文章你可能也喜欢:

  • 暂无相关推荐文章

本文由主机参考刊发,转载请注明:SSL证书的加密算法有哪些?主要有五种(ssl加密技术的基本原理) https://zhujicankao.com/103546.html

【腾讯云】领8888元采购礼包,抢爆款云服务器 每月 9元起,个人开发者加享折上折!
打赏
转载请注明原文链接:主机参考 » SSL证书的加密算法有哪些?主要有五种(ssl加密技术的基本原理)
主机参考仅做资料收集,不对商家任何信息及交易做信用担保,购买前请注意风险,有交易纠纷请自行解决!请查阅:特别声明

评论 抢沙发

评论前必须登录!